Responsibilities

Designs, builds, tests, implements, and supports information technology solutions to meet operational and clinical needs.

Also, provides consultation for program design, coding, testing, debugging and documentation.

Understands system options and configurations completely and can suggest and lead teams through decisions on the best way to configure and utilize the system.

Analyzes, designs, and makes recommendations to improve existing systems and/or methods, and provide written, detailed reports.

Creates thorough system design and build documentation.

Collaborates with other analysts, staff, vendors, and leadership.

Translate high-level business requirements to detailed technical designs/documentation.

Leads large/complex projects or initiatives.

Supports/maintains day-to-day existing functionality/programs/applications including ancillary systems support.


Coordinates all phases of a system optimization or upgrade project and provides production services, such as recommending improvements to strategy, system usage and process through the application of business and technology skill sets.

Supports continued system maintenance and optimization.

Serves as resource and advocate for assigned user group(s). Assists with a variety of related projects and staff education on an ad hoc basis. Provide solutions for application issues and complex support for trouble shooting difficult situations. Acts as the group resources for complex issues needing resolution. Mentors other analysts on troubleshooting issues of intermediate to advanced complexity and creating system design solutions.


Performs advanced system analysis and troubleshooting to implement new functionality/programs/applications, and to analyze/research vendor release notes and documentation; understanding complete end-to-end system integration.

Identifies and manages new system specifications or user services and coordination of installations.

Assesses assigned user areas for efficiencies and effectiveness. Evaluates alternative services and technology solutions on an ongoing basis and assures cost-effective solutions. Responsible for providing systems support. Ability to coordinate various systems.

Coordinates the preparation of departmental and interdepartmental policies and procedures, job functions, operating procedures, manuals, and system documentation. Performs advanced analysis using databases and data reporting tools.

Maintains complete and up-to-date project documentation for all assigned projects. Meeting with department heads on a routine basis to identify and prioritize their needs.

Works closely with customers to document requirements and communicate effectively with customers and peers to implement changes.

Facilitates performance improvement for the effective use of information technology. Assists in identifying any barriers to adoption of clinical practice. Supports business/clinical operations with clinical and financial end users.

Analyze the functionality of system and how it fits or not with operations; The ability to troubleshoot basic problems and recommend and take appropriate action as required.

Qualifications

Bachelor's degree in related field; 4 years of equivalent experience may be considered in lieu of Bachelor's degree.

3 years working with systems analysis programming/design.


5 years of additional relevant experience: application support, implementation or development experience with applications in a hospital or medical related industry is required.

Demonstrated innovative and creative Epic solutions.

Works at the highest technical level of all phases of applications, systems analysis and programming activities.

Demonstrated excellence in oral and written communication.

Comprehensive knowledge of healthcare operations required.


EPIC certification for the area in which you support (in primary application) is required or required within 4 months of employment.

Ongoing maintenance of Epic certification(s) required.
